Sophia - My daughter is a few years older (y10) now but she was 25th on the waiting list and got offered a place in July and there were a few more (maybe up to place 30) offered by first week of September. It did go in waves so there were periods were you got a few get in one week then none for a month. It also looked like there was some grammar school swapping going on as when the Essex grammars moved a week later Woodford moved. I would think your daughter will get in and even once they start there is some movement especially first week when some who have taken private offers don't turn up.

I think in y7 2 girls left over the year so not a lot but it does happen. My daughter goes to a different school now in a different area so I don't know last few years but sometimes people post here.
